Resumen
¿Desea enviar mensajes de pedido personalizados directamente a WhatsApp del cliente mediante la API de Wati? Esta guía lo lleva a través de cómo usar el punto de conexión POST /api/v1/order_details_template para enviar un mensaje estructurado que incluye artículos de pedido, precios y opciones de pago. También encontrará una carga de muestra para ayudarlo a empezar rápidamente.
Nota: Transmisiones ahora son Campañas – mismas características poderosas, nombre actualizado!
Punto de conexión
POST https://{your-account-endpoint}/api/v1/order_details_template
El punto de conexión order_details_template le permite enviar un mensaje de plantilla de detalles de pedido a WhatsApp de un cliente. Puede incluir uno o más artículos en el mensaje, especificar precios y enlazarlo a una pasarela de pago como PayU, Razorpay, etc.
Paso 1: Localice su punto de conexión de API
Puede encontrar su punto de conexión de API específico en la sección /api-docs en su cuenta de Wati. Tendrá un aspecto similar a este: https://live-server-xxxx.wati.io
Su punto de conexión final para enviar el pedido será:
POST https://{your-account-endpoint}/api/v1/order_details_template
Paso 2: Entienda la importancia de reference_id
Cada mensaje de pedido debe incluir un reference_id único. Usted genera este valor y lo usa para realizar un seguimiento de cada pedido. Ningún pedido debe tener el mismo reference_id.
Paso 3: Estructura su carga
Aquí hay una carga de muestra que muestra cómo dar formato a su order_details_template. Puede personalizar campos como el nombre del producto, precio, detalles del importador y configuración de pago según sea necesario.
Carga de muestra
curl --location 'https://mt-dev-gke-server.watiapp.io/103128/api/v1/order_deta' \
--header 'Authorization: Bearer <TOKEN>' \
--header 'Content-Type: application/json' \
--data '{
"phone_number": "918606328257",
"template_name": "order_details_template_yzn_1",
"language_code": "en_US",
"is_campaign": true,
"custom_params": [
{
"name": "name",
"value": "Madhavan"
},
{
"name": "discount",
"value": "60%"
}
],
"order_details": {
"reference_id": "yzn-test-6",
"type": "digital-goods",
"payment_configuration": "razorpay_test_payment_2",
"payment_type": "payment_gateway:razorpay",
"currency": "INR",
"total_amount": {
"offset": 100,
"value": 100
},
"order": {
"discount": {
"offset": 100,
"value": 100
},
"items": [
{
"name": "ORDER_ITEM_NAME",
"quantity": 1,
"retailer_id": "ORDER_ITEM_RETAILER_ID",
"country_of_origin": "ORIGIN_COUNTRY",
"importer_name": "IMPORTER_NAME",
"amount": {
"offset": 100,
"value": 100
},
"importer_address": {
"address_line1": "IMPORTER_ADDRESS",
"city": "CITY",
"country_code": "COUNTRY",
"postal_code": "ZIP_CODE"
}
}
],
"shipping": {
"offset": 100,
"value": 0
},
"status": "pending",
"subtotal": {
"offset": 100,
"value": 100
},
"tax": {
"offset": 100,
"value": 100
}
}
}
}'
Notas
Moneda y desplazamientos: Los valores de cantidad utilizan un sistema de desplazamiento (por ejemplo, valor: 21000 y desplazamiento: 100 = ₹210,00).
Detalles del producto: Puede enviar varios productos en un mensaje.
Encabezado de imagen: Proporcione una URL de medios válida para mostrar una imagen en la parte superior del mensaje.
Pasarela de pago: La pasarela de pago compatible con Facebook, por ejemplo: Razorpay, Payu, Zaakpay y Billdesk.
Cómo enlazar su cuenta de pago a Facebook
Para recibir pagos en WhatsApp, necesita enlazar su pasarela de pago a su cuenta de negocios de WhatsApp a través de una configuración de pago.
Aquí hay una guía visual rápida:
Cómo crear una plantilla de detalles de pedido en Wati
¿Quiere enviar información de pedido de manera rápida y clara a sus clientes? Utilice la plantilla Detalles de pedido en Wati para diseñar y enviar mensajes estructurados. Esta guía lo lleva a través de los pasos para crear uno en solo unos pocos clics.
Siga estos pasos para configurar una plantilla de detalles de pedido en Wati:
1. Inicie sesión en su cuenta de Wati.
2. Vaya a Campañas y seleccione Mensajes de plantilla.
3. Haga clic en Nuevo mensaje de plantilla.
4. Introduzca un nombre para su plantilla para que pueda encontrarla fácilmente más adelante.
5. En Categoría, elija Marketing o Utilidad
6. Seleccione el idioma que desee para la plantilla.
7. En Seleccionar plantilla de marketing, elija Detalles de pedido.
8. Elija cómo desea que comience el mensaje:
Para agregar un texto o imagen como título, seleccione Texto o Imagen en Título de la campaña.
Si prefiere omitir el título y comenzar con el cuerpo, elija Ninguno en Título de la campaña.
9. Introduzca su contenido del cuerpo—este es el mensaje principal que verá su cliente.
10. Una vez que todo tenga un buen aspecto, haga clic en Guardar y enviar.
¡Eso es todo! Su plantilla de detalles de pedido ahora está lista para usar en sus campañas.
Nota: Puede crear la plantilla de detalles de pedido bajo la categoría de Marketing y también la categoría de Utilidad.



